MTFR Station 81

Miami Township Fire-Rescue is keen to attract enthusiastic volunteers who are interested in being trained to serve our community as EMT's. Members are trained, AT NO EXPENSE to the volunteer, to be Nationally Registered Emergency Medical Technicians, able to respond to a wide range of medical emergencies in our advanced life support equipped ambulances. EMT's also lend support to our firefighters when responding to structure fires and rescues. Once trained, members volunteer their time according to their own availability and receive a small stipend on a per call basis. Volunteer members also have the opportunity to be further trained as firefighters if they wish.
